Below is a note from 'Micro-LOL-Soft' about installing NetFramework 3.0 on
Vista.

Antivirus applications that are configured to clean the Temp folder will cause setup to fail if setup needs to reboot.
If setup needs to reboot, and the antivirus application is set to clean the Temp directory on launch, necessary setup files will be deleted and setup will fail with a program-not-found error.

To resolve this issue

Change your antivirus applications configuration to not clean the Temp folder on launch or reboot before running .NET Framework 3.0 setup. Consult your antivirus documentation for the steps to accomplish this.
